Scaling a tech company comes with complex legal, governance, and compliance challenges.
Company Governance session is a space for founders, C-suite, and legal leaders to learn from peers and experts who have navigated these challenges firsthand.

What to expect

  • AMA Space: Board Liabilities and Dynamics
    Led by Freek Hilberdink and Bastiaan Kemp from Loyens & Loeff, covering how board responsibilities evolve during scaling and how founders can protect themselves while managing investors and complex decisions.

  • Breakout Conversations
    You can choose one of the two parallel group discussions where founders and experts exchange perspectives on:

    1. Safeguarding your IP & Innovation — How to safeguard IP, manage ownership, and collaborate on innovation. Recommended for Deeptech companies.
    2. Compliance & Risk Management — How to stay compliant, manage risk, and build trust with regulators while scaling. Recommended for Fintech, SaaS, or AI companies.
  • Networking & Wrap-Up
    Continue the conversation over drinks with peers and legal experts in an informal setting.

The topics we will cover include:

  • Board structure and governance
  • Investor relations and shareholder dynamics
  • Intellectual property and innovation protection
  • Compliance and regulatory alignment
  • Contracts and partnerships

Who this session is for

This gathering is for founders and senior leaders responsible for steering their company’s growth and navigating legal, governance, or compliance challenges that come with scaling.

Examples include Founders (technical or commercial), CEOs, COOs, CFOs, CTOs, Heads of Legal, Heads of Operations, Scientific Managers, and IP Managers, or any senior leader involved in strategic decision-making, partnerships, or risk management.
